On Thursday July 28, the Chester County School system held their Back-to-School In-service Program to start the 2022-2023 Academic Year. During the program, Chester County Director of Schools Troy Kilzer II recognized the retirees, 10-Year Pin Award recipients, 20-Year Pin Award recipients and the 30-Year Pin Award recipients. Additionally, the Chester County Schools 2022 Hometown Heroes were announced by Modern Woodmen’s Ronnie Geary Jr. Pictured are Geary and the Hometown Heroes honorees. Left to right: Ronnie Geary Jr., James Carter (CCHS), Sandy Lewis (East Chester), Crystal Wilson (Chester County Middle School), Rachel Morris (Jacks Creek) and Bo Bates (West Chester). Hometown Heroes not pictured are Dock Ivy (North Chester) and Tanya Harwell (Chester County Junior High). See page 7-A for pictures of all of the recipients present that day.
